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following:

  • Provide professional customer service by answering phones, greeting visitors, and directing citizens to appropriate resources or personnel.
  • Support the preparation and organization of criminal case files for submission to prosecuting authorities.
  • Perform traffic citation data entry and records management functions.
  • Participate in the processing, packaging, logging, storage, and auditing of property and evidence in accordance with department procedures.
  • Receive and document basic information for walk-in reports and citizen inquiries.
  • Compile and assist with monthly statistical and operational reports.
  • Support the planning, coordination, and participation in community engagement and crime prevention events.
  • Contribute to the department's social media and public information efforts as part of the community engagement strategy.
  • Assist with accreditation preparation activities, including organizing files and maintaining proofs of compliance.
  • Provide logistical and administrative support for department training programs and special events.
  • Support crime analysis and intelligence functions through research, data review, information organization, and the identification of crime trends or patterns.
  • Attend supervisory meetings, City Council meetings, Citizen Advisory Board meetings, and other meetings as requested.
  • Support inventory management and organizational projects involving department equipment, supplies, and operational resources.
  • Other duties as may be assigned by supervisors.

Education and/or Experience

High School graduation or its equivalent

Experience in prior customer service preferred

Must have a friendly disposition

Must be able to stay calm in stressful, fast-paced situations

Skills/Ability To: Strong analytical skills, ability to be flexible and multitask, responsible Ability to lift and carry up to 50 pounds

Certificates, Licenses, Registrations Valid Texas driver's license.

Hourly Rate $15.00
